In late 2001, Doug Del Gaudio and Stephen Forys met in highschool. When they had heard that a talent show was being held at the school they decided to sign up, later finding out that they had common musical influences. They began writing songs and needed a guitarist. After many failed candidates, long time friend Chris Loret was found and Airdate was formed. In 2007, bass player Dan Mccabe chose to leave the band due to creative differences. Long time friend Bryan Wichelman, also known as Fry, was asked to join to complete the line-up.
In the summer of 2007, Airdate recorded an EP with former bassist Dan Mccabe, The Kung Fu girls and John Neclario (My Chemical Romance, The Ataris and Brand New) at Nada Studios. Airdate then released the EP “Getting Off the Ground” on i-tunes, Napster and Amazon Mp3 in July of 2007.
In the past year, Airdates fan base has been constantly growing and expanding to different parts of the world. Music sharing websites such as PureVolume and MySpace has helped display the bands music, reaching over 200,000 people and over 200,000 plays in such a short period of time. They have recently been featured several times on music sharing website known as PureVolume.com, receiving more plays then chart topping Billboard artists such as Avril Lavigne, Fall Out Boy, and My Chemical Romance, becoming the 1 unsigned band by plays and downloads several times.
